In one paragraph

Theory of Mind (Human) is modeling what others think, feel, and intend. It sits in the Biology dimension (BIO) of the Human Behavior Taxonomy™ as element HBT-BIO-0081, within the Social Brain family. The core principle: modeling what others think, feel, and intend. In incentive terms, it matters because it changes the payoff people perceive before they choose — which means it can be designed for, or exploited.
